Output 19c96d6881579c5f75a49a4b64c1898499abce9b4933584763017d820a5fee5f:3

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c4e326cb40a39af8aa6d31c173fd152792759ed OP_EQUALVERIFY OP_CHECKSIG
address
1M5sLRZf4vqzbFLpDcWEA6jVmfaaYLaWeb
transaction
19c96d6881579c5f75a49a4b64c1898499abce9b4933584763017d820a5fee5f
spent
true